K. Terashi is a scholar working on Nuclear and High Energy Physics, Artificial Intelligence and Computer Networks and Communications. According to data from OpenAlex, K. Terashi has authored 15 papers receiving a total of 215 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Nuclear and High Energy Physics, 7 papers in Artificial Intelligence and 2 papers in Computer Networks and Communications. Recurrent topics in K. Terashi’s work include Particle physics theoretical and experimental studies (10 papers), Quantum Computing Algorithms and Architecture (6 papers) and High-Energy Particle Collisions Research (6 papers). K. Terashi is often cited by papers focused on Particle physics theoretical and experimental studies (10 papers), Quantum Computing Algorithms and Architecture (6 papers) and High-Energy Particle Collisions Research (6 papers). K. Terashi collaborates with scholars based in Japan, United States and Switzerland. K. Terashi's co-authors include R. Sawada, Shinya Matsuzaki, Koichi Yamawaki, M. Saito, W. Guan, Maria Schuld, Arthur Pesah, Gabriel Perdue, S. Vallecorsa and Jean-Roch Vlimant and has published in prestigious journals such as Nuclear Physics B, Physics Letters B and Journal of High Energy Physics.
